What is a common consequence of dilution in serum for dialysis patients?

Prepare for the Certified Specialist In Renal Nutrition exam with our comprehensive quiz. Utilize flashcards and multiple choice questions with explanations to ace your test!

Dialysis patients often experience fluctuations in their serum concentrations due to the replacement of fluid and electrolytes during treatment. When dilution occurs in the serum, it can lead to falsely low lab values, particularly for substances such as serum sodium, potassium, calcium, and even certain proteins. This dilution effect arises because the total volume of fluid in the bloodstream increases, but the actual quantities of these substances do not change proportionately, leading to lower readings on laboratory tests.

For example, if a patient's volume status increases due to fluid overload or excessive fluid intake, the concentration of solutes can be diluted, resulting in laboratory values that may not accurately reflect the patient's true metabolic state. This misrepresentation can complicate clinical decision-making, potentially leading to inappropriate adjustments in treatment or dialysis regimens. Understanding this phenomenon is crucial for healthcare providers managing renal patients to ensure accurate interpretation of lab tests and appropriate care planning.
